Strong limited slip for 9"
Currently have a spool, but am changing gears and tires to radials. I don't think the spool is going to work well with the radials (et streets), so I'm looking for a good limited slip. I havent heard good things about lockers. Act funny on the street, and dont always lock at the track. 31 spline.
Suggestions?
